An advisory committee to the Oregon Workers’ Compensation Board will meet on Dec. 17 to discuss a rule concept regarding obtaining “individual identifiable health information” through a subpoena.
The meeting, which starts at 9 a.m., will take place in Portland at 16760 SW Upper Boones Ferry Road, Suite 220, Hearing Room G.
